Roosevelt attacks pacifist peace policy in Detroit speech
In Detroit on American Day Colonel Roosevelt condemned peace pacifists as prototypes of Copperheads and Tories. He extolled preparedness and the big stick in a one-and-a-half hour talk, praising Ford while contrasting Belgium and Korea under conquest. The event drew a full theatre audience and sparked campaign-like fervor.

Pacifists, Tories, and the crisis of preparedness
The piece contrasts revolutionary era Copperheads and Civil War pacifists with wartime viewpoints. It cites Colonel Roosevelt and Mr Ford’s followers on Americanism and preparedness, arguing pacifists would have hindered national unity and fueled suffering if their aims prevailed. It ends noting Corporal Kiffen Rockwell of Atlanta reported downing a German plane near Hartmannswellerkopf.

Will Patrol the Border From U S Forces Arrive at Columbus
Eight hundred American cavalrymen reached Columbus New Mexico riding through a dust storm and began camp duty. The Sixth Cavalry assigned to border patrol east and west of Boquillas, part of a reallocation after a border conference. Meanwhile Mexican bands under Hernandez and Garcia threaten the Big Bend area as Sibley’s expedition advances toward Boquillas.
